Joe Klecko is a former professional American football player who played as a defensive tackle for the New York Jets, renowned for his tenacity and skill on the field. A key member of the Jets' famed 'New York Sack Exchange,' Klecko was a three-time Pro Bowler and was inducted into the New York Jets Ring of Honor. His career was marked by both individual accolades and team success, contributing significantly to the Jets' defense during the 1980s. Recently, he was in the news after being granted a presidential pardon for a previous conviction related to insurance fraud.
